Maggie Baugh: Talent, Rumors, and the Cost of a Viral Moment
Maggie Baugh came to Nashville with a guitar, a notebook of lyrics, and the hope of building a life in music. At 25, she had already carved out a place for herself as a rising songwriter and instrumentalist. But one unscripted moment onstage with Keith Urban has thrust her into a spotlight she never sought.
On October 1, 2025, while performing The Fighter — a song long tied to Urban’s former wife Nicole Kidman — the country star playfully swapped the lyric “baby, I’ll be the fighter” with “Maggie, I’ll be your guitar player.” The change was fleeting, but captured on phones, it ricocheted online within hours. The timing, coming so soon after Urban’s divorce announcement, only fueled speculation.
